The Blowing Danger: Wind Advisory In Effect
Residents are urged to practice extreme caution as a wind advisory is currently in effect. Gusts of around 40 miles per hour are expected, creating potentially dangerous conditions. Trees and tops could be blown, resulting in power outages and property damage. Loose objects should be tied down to prevent them from becoming airborne hazards. Motorists are advised to travel with extra caution, as strong winds can click here reduce visibility and control of vehicles. It is best to avoid unnecessary travel until the advisory has been lifted.

Caution: Strong Winds Expected, Remain Sheltered
Residents are advised to exercise utmost caution as powerful winds are predicted throughout the day. These winds could lead to destruction to property and create a threat to residents. It is strongly recommended that you remain indoors until the winds subside.
- Monitor local weather reports for the latest information.
- Tie down any loose objects outside, such as trash cans, to prevent them from becoming airborne.
- Refrain from areas with exposed structures that could be damaged by the wind.
